Understanding Ethernet Controllers and Driver Software
Before delving into the specifics of the VIA Rhine Ethernet Controller Driver 1.15A, it’s crucial to understand the role of Ethernet controllers and the importance of driver software in the context of computer networking. An Ethernet controller, also known as a Network Interface Card (NIC), is a hardware component that enables a computer to connect to a network, typically a Local Area Network (LAN), using the Ethernet protocol. It acts as a bridge between the computer’s internal systems and the external network, handling the transmission and reception of data packets.
Driver software, on the other hand, is a specialized type of software that allows the operating system to interact with and control a specific hardware device. Without the correct driver, the operating system would be unable to recognize and utilize the full functionality of the Ethernet controller. The driver provides the necessary instructions and protocols for the operating system to send commands to the controller, receive data from it, and manage its various features.
